Output 8c8c19c8eaace5168bda6fccea2d089a13dfdc9917cbb18bdb0035989640a7a1:1

value
53399317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9f3c11fa65fc19ab75636c25a4b118e2e914f87 OP_EQUAL
address
3QUeBfKDPVAbQWYUuiaaajWsHpixkh1CEN
transaction
8c8c19c8eaace5168bda6fccea2d089a13dfdc9917cbb18bdb0035989640a7a1
confirmations
437673
spent
true